One-Time Fee

  • $3,200 and up (broken up into two payments, half upfront and the other half after engagement)

  • Includes 4-6 meetings over the next 3 months

  • Short-term engagement (at least 10 hours in total)

  • Will cover many of your main goals and priorities by setting you up for success for the next few years

Ongoing Partnership

  • $6,180 / year (broken up to $515 per month

  • Includes many meetings and an ongoing relationship for as long as you wish to hire me.

  • This includes the total package: tax planning, comprehensive financial planning, and everything in between from a trusted financial partner for the long term.

One-Time Fee

  • $360/hour (billed in increments of 5 mins)

  • Need one off guidance? Just a few hours here and there? This would be the best model.

  • We will advise you on all personal and business matters and be there for you when you need us most.
